ctrl+alt+shift+s ---->artifacts---->output layout------>右键Avaulable下面的struts包
打开IDEA,在创建好的project中,选择File->Project Structure。如何在Intellij IDEA中创建struts2模块
然后切换到module选项卡,点击绿色的"+",选择New Module。
如何在Intellij IDEA中创建struts2模块
然后再Java Enterprise选项卡中选择Struts2,Java EE版本选择Java EE 5,并选择Tomcat服务器。我已经下载过struts的库文件,直接使用use library即可。若初次使用,选择Download。
如何在Intellij IDEA中创建struts2模块
点击Next,输入module的名称,并点击Finish。
如何在Intellij IDEA中创建struts2模块
这时,系统已经默认为你创建了必备的一些配置文件。我们这里写一个简单的struts2版本的Hello World程序。在src下面创建一个子包为action的包,如com.baidu.action,然后创建一个类为DemoAction。
如何在Intellij IDEA中创建struts2模块
如何在Intellij IDEA中创建struts2模块
在DemoAction中创建一个返回值为String、名称为execute的方法(名称以及返回值不能是其他值),这里返回"success"。
如何在Intellij IDEA中创建struts2模块
7
在welcome.jsp中输入<h1>Hello World</h1><br>用来提示跳转。
如何在Intellij IDEA中创建struts2模块
8
在struts中配置DemoAction的执行路径,其中红框中的部分是不能改变的。其他部分可重新命名。
如何在Intellij IDEA中创建struts2模块
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)